   1/* SPDX-License-Identifier: GPL-2.0-only */
   2/*
   3 * oxfw.h - a part of driver for OXFW970/971 based devices
   4 *
   5 * Copyright (c) Clemens Ladisch <clemens@ladisch.de>
   6 */
   7
   8#include <linux/device.h>
   9#include <linux/firewire.h>
  10#include <linux/firewire-constants.h>
  11#include <linux/module.h>
  12#include <linux/mod_devicetable.h>
  13#include <linux/mutex.h>
  14#include <linux/slab.h>
  15#include <linux/compat.h>
  16#include <linux/sched/signal.h>
  17
  18#include <sound/control.h>
  19#include <sound/core.h>
  20#include <sound/initval.h>
  21#include <sound/pcm.h>
  22#include <sound/pcm_params.h>
  23#include <sound/info.h>
  24#include <sound/rawmidi.h>
  25#include <sound/firewire.h>
  26#include <sound/hwdep.h>
  27
  28#include "../lib.h"
  29#include "../fcp.h"
  30#include "../packets-buffer.h"
  31#include "../iso-resources.h"
  32#include "../amdtp-am824.h"
  33#include "../cmp.h"
  34
  35/* This is an arbitrary number for convinience. */
  36#define SND_OXFW_STREAM_FORMAT_ENTRIES  10
  37struct snd_oxfw {
  38        struct snd_card *card;
  39        struct fw_unit *unit;
  40        struct mutex mutex;
  41        spinlock_t lock;
  42
  43        bool registered;
  44        struct delayed_work dwork;
  45
  46        bool wrong_dbs;
  47        bool has_output;
  48        bool has_input;
  49        u8 *tx_stream_formats[SND_OXFW_STREAM_FORMAT_ENTRIES];
  50        u8 *rx_stream_formats[SND_OXFW_STREAM_FORMAT_ENTRIES];
  51        bool assumed;
  52        struct cmp_connection out_conn;
  53        struct cmp_connection in_conn;
  54        struct amdtp_stream tx_stream;
  55        struct amdtp_stream rx_stream;
  56        unsigned int substreams_count;
  57
  58        unsigned int midi_input_ports;
  59        unsigned int midi_output_ports;
  60
  61        int dev_lock_count;
  62        bool dev_lock_changed;
  63        wait_queue_head_t hwdep_wait;
  64
  65        const struct ieee1394_device_id *entry;
  66        void *spec;
  67
  68        struct amdtp_domain domain;
  69};
  70
  71/*
  72 * AV/C Stream Format Information Specification 1.1 Working Draft
  73 * (Apr 2005, 1394TA)
  74 */
  75int avc_stream_set_format(struct fw_unit *unit, enum avc_general_plug_dir dir,
  76                          unsigned int pid, u8 *format, unsigned int len);
  77int avc_stream_get_format(struct fw_unit *unit,
  78                          enum avc_general_plug_dir dir, unsigned int pid,
  79                          u8 *buf, unsigned int *len, unsigned int eid);
  80static inline int
  81avc_stream_get_format_single(struct fw_unit *unit,
  82                             enum avc_general_plug_dir dir, unsigned int pid,
  83                             u8 *buf, unsigned int *len)
  84{
  85        return avc_stream_get_format(unit, dir, pid, buf, len, 0xff);
  86}
  87static inline int
  88avc_stream_get_format_list(struct fw_unit *unit,
  89                           enum avc_general_plug_dir dir, unsigned int pid,
  90                           u8 *buf, unsigned int *len,
  91                           unsigned int eid)
  92{
  93        return avc_stream_get_format(unit, dir, pid, buf, len, eid);
  94}
  95
  96/*
  97 * AV/C Digital Interface Command Set General Specification 4.2
  98 * (Sep 2004, 1394TA)
  99 */
 100int avc_general_inquiry_sig_fmt(struct fw_unit *unit, unsigned int rate,
 101                                enum avc_general_plug_dir dir,
 102                                unsigned short pid);
 103
 104int snd_oxfw_stream_init_duplex(struct snd_oxfw *oxfw);
 105int snd_oxfw_stream_reserve_duplex(struct snd_oxfw *oxfw,
 106                                   struct amdtp_stream *stream,
 107                                   unsigned int rate, unsigned int pcm_channels,
 108                                   unsigned int frames_per_period,
 109                                   unsigned int frames_per_buffer);
 110int snd_oxfw_stream_start_duplex(struct snd_oxfw *oxfw);
 111void snd_oxfw_stream_stop_duplex(struct snd_oxfw *oxfw);
 112void snd_oxfw_stream_destroy_duplex(struct snd_oxfw *oxfw);
 113void snd_oxfw_stream_update_duplex(struct snd_oxfw *oxfw);
 114
 115struct snd_oxfw_stream_formation {
 116        unsigned int rate;
 117        unsigned int pcm;
 118        unsigned int midi;
 119};
 120int snd_oxfw_stream_parse_format(u8 *format,
 121                                 struct snd_oxfw_stream_formation *formation);
 122int snd_oxfw_stream_get_current_formation(struct snd_oxfw *oxfw,
 123                                enum avc_general_plug_dir dir,
 124                                struct snd_oxfw_stream_formation *formation);
 125
 126int snd_oxfw_stream_discover(struct snd_oxfw *oxfw);
 127
 128void snd_oxfw_stream_lock_changed(struct snd_oxfw *oxfw);
 129int snd_oxfw_stream_lock_try(struct snd_oxfw *oxfw);
 130void snd_oxfw_stream_lock_release(struct snd_oxfw *oxfw);
 131
 132int snd_oxfw_create_pcm(struct snd_oxfw *oxfw);
 133
 134void snd_oxfw_proc_init(struct snd_oxfw *oxfw);
 135
 136int snd_oxfw_create_midi(struct snd_oxfw *oxfw);
 137
 138int snd_oxfw_create_hwdep(struct snd_oxfw *oxfw);
 139
 140int snd_oxfw_add_spkr(struct snd_oxfw *oxfw, bool is_lacie);
 141int snd_oxfw_scs1x_add(struct snd_oxfw *oxfw);
 142void snd_oxfw_scs1x_update(struct snd_oxfw *oxfw);
